Ambient Clinical Analytics Raises $5M, Appoints Brian Tufts as CEO
What You Should Know
The Capital: Ambient Clinical Analytics has closed a $5M strategic funding round. Investors include Mairs & Power Venture Capital and an unnamed Fortune 500 MedTech firm.The Leadership Shift: Brian Tufts, a veteran executive with experience at Vantive and Baxter, has been appointed as the new Chief Executive Officer. FDB Launches MedProof MCP to Ground AI Agents in Clinical Drug Knowledge
What You Should Know
The Launch: FDB (First Databank) has announced the general availability of FDB MedProof MCP, the healthcare industry's first Model Context Protocol (MCP) server purpose-built for AI medication decision support.The Protocol: MCP is an emerging, open-source standard that defines how AI agents and Large Language Models (LLMs) interact with external knowledge bases. WHOOP Secures $575M to Accelerate Global Expansion for Human Performance Platform
What You Should Know
The Funding: Human performance company WHOOP has raised $575M in a Series G funding round, bringing the company's valuation to a staggering $10.1 billion.The Backers: The round was led by Collaborative Fund and included heavy-hitting institutional participation from Qatar Investment Authority (QIA), Mubadala, Abbott, and the Mayo Clinic, alongside prominent elite athletes like Cristiano Ronaldo, LeBron James, and Rory McIlroy.

Public Health: ARPA-H Announces $144M STOMP Program to Measure and Remove Microplastics
What You Should Know
The Launch: The Advanced Research Projects Agency for Health (ARPA-H) has announced STOMP (Systematic Targeting Of MicroPlastics), a massive $144 million nationwide program.The Ultimate Goal: STOMP aims to develop tools that are fast, affordable, and broadly available, specifically protecting vulnerable populations like pregnant women, children, and highly exposed workers from long-term disease.

KLAS Research Releases 2026 First Look Report on Abridge Ambient AI for Nursing
What You Should Know
The Baseline Score: In its "First Look" Emerging Insights Report, KLAS Research awarded Abridge Ambient AI for Nursing an overall performance score of 94.3 on a 100-point scale. KLAS notes this is based on limited, early-adopter data from 9 individuals across 6 organizations.The Core Functionality: The solution utilizes conversational AI to convert verbalized nursing observations and patient care into drafted flowsheet documentation within the EHR. Commure Launches AI-Powered Speech-to-Cursor Dictation Tool for Clinical Workflows
What You Should Know
The Launch: Revenue cycle and clinical AI platform Commure has launched Commure Dictation, an AI-powered "speech-to-cursor" extension.Hardware Independence: The tool eliminates the need for expensive, dedicated dictation hardware. Clinicians can simply use the Commure Ambient mobile app as a wireless microphone.

Marathon Health Appoints Chris Pricco as CEO to Accelerate Advanced Primary Care Growth
What You Should Know
Marathon Health has appointed Chris Pricco as its new Chief Executive Officer. He succeeds co-founder and longtime CEO Dr. Jeff Wells, who will remain with the company as a board member.
